St. Lawrence County Libraries Sweep Top Three Prizes at Battle of the Books

The North Country Library System annual Battle of the Books competition took place Saturday, May 20th in Gouverneur. Fifteen teams of 4th, 5th, and 6th grade children from St. Lawrence, Jefferson, and Lewis Counties competed in a double-elimination competition consisting of trivia questions based on twenty books the children read and studied in depth.  Congratulations to The Bookie Monsters from the Canton Free Library for bringing home the first place trophy! The team included Griffin Scafidi-McGuire, Maya Thomas, Natalie Todd, Claire Waters, and Coach Heidi Todd. St. Lawrence County Libraries Lend Over 15,000 Items Through Interlibrary Loan

Interlibrary Loan (ILL) is a free service provided by our local libraries in conjunction with the North Country Library System (NCLS). ILL allows libraries to share items through the NCLS delivery system, giving patrons easy access to a diverse collection of materials. Thus far in 2017, NCLS has transported 42,802 books, movies, and other items between 65 public libraries in St. Lawrence, Jefferson, Oswego, and Lewis Counties. In St. Lawrence County, our public libraries have lent 15,486 items through interlibrary loan. St. Lawrence County Libraries Offer Computers and Internet Access

All libraries in St. Lawrence County offer free internet access to visitors. Some libraries offer desktop computers while others also have laptops or tablets that may be used throughout the library building. A few libraries also allow patrons to borrow e-readers to take home for a limited period of time.  Libraries offer wi-fi access for your smart devices or laptops. Wi-fi range is usually throughout the entire building, and may extend outside to the parking lot or lawn where it may be accessed after hours.
